Club Championships
The 2011 Club Championships will be held from 4th of April to the 11th of June. The draw for each tournament is available here. Please see each tab for the open, veteran's, handicap and doubles competitions.

Here's the other info you need to know:
- - First round matches need to be completed by Sunday 8th May.
- - Entry is £3 for one tournament, £5 for two, £6 for three or more.
- - Players must pay for their own court booking and lighting (except in the final). There are envelopes behind the bar for entry fees.
- - The organisers reserve the right to eliminate players who have not paid entry fees by 30th April.
- - The final will be played on Saturday 11th June
- - Players are responsible for organising matches within the time allowed for each round, if the match is not played by the allotted time the organisers reserve the right to eliminate the player lower in the draw.
- - There will be open, veterans, handicap and racketball singles competitions, plus a doubles tournament so long as there are a minimum of 8 entries
- - Top players will be seeded (apart from in handicap)
- - Play best of 5 games, English scoring, first to 9 points other than Handicap which is American scoring to 15.
- - The winner’s prize is to have their name engraved on the club trophy and on the winners board in the bar. The club might throw in a couple of other prizes along the way.
